Consider the following statements.
1. Coordination means synchronisation of efforts with respect to time and direction.
2. The basic principles of coordination are direct contact and continuity of efforts.
3. In a given situation, cooperation may exist without coordination.
Which of the statement(s) given above is/are correct?

A. Only 1

B. Only 2

C. Both 1 and 2

D. All of the above

Answer: Option D
